water pump
A water pump is a machine that transports or pressurizes liquid. It transfers the mechanical energy or other external energy of the prime mover to the liquid, which increases the energy of the liquid. Mainly used for conveying liquids, including water, oil, acid-base liquid, emulsion, suspension emulsion and liquid metal. It can also transport liquids, gas mixtures and liquids containing suspended solids.
The technical parameters of pump performance include flow, suction, lift, shaft power, hydraulic power and efficiency. According to different working principles, it can be divided into positive displacement pump and vane pump. The displacement pump uses the change of its working chamber volume to transfer energy; Vane pumps use the interaction between rotating blades and water to transfer energy, including centrifugal pumps, axial pumps and mixed-flow pumps.
